The Cherry Valley Feeder Hopper Feeder with Suet Cages is designed for bird enthusiasts who want to attract a variety of feathered friends. With its dual-sided suet basket, snap-on latches for easy filling, and a no waste seed saver baffle, this feeder combines convenience and sustainability, holding up to 5.5 pounds of mixed seed and suet.

not a perfect feeder but the birds love it
This is a big favorite in my backyard although it's not MY favorite.....but the birds are the voters here! I like the size....it's perfect for one 4# bag of seed which is how I get a lot of my bird food locally. It's certainly NOT squirrel proof or resistant, but again....the birds LOVE it. I typically put woodpecker seed (lots of nuts) in and use mealworm suet in the suet holders. I just got my second feeder, which replaced a previous feeders (same model) that the squirrels had bashed to death. The screws holding the wire holder had worked loose and the squirrels had a fine time jumping onto the feeder which eventually went crashing to the ground, bending the perch shut on one end of one side. Also, the suet feeders are loosey-goosey and I had to put clips on the top and bottom to prevent the squirrels from simply opening the suet holder and carting off the cake. The second feeder doesn't seem to HOLD the suet cages well, and every day when I come home I find the suet holders on the ground. I'll have to figure out a better way to secure them to the feeder. Through time the little prongs that hold the suet cages break off as well....probably due to squirrel abuse OR the weight of the pileated woodpeckers that love the suet. Despite all these quibbles, I listen to the birds! I get 4 kinds of woodpeckers on this feeder, in addition to 2 species of chickadee, red-breasted nuthatches, juncos and last month I photographed a Townsend's warbler eating suet!

Perch too small for most bigger birds
My yard is full of birds but, we were battling raccoons at night so we had to get a new feeder. We feed suet and black oil sunflower seeds year round. It has been 2 weeks since this new feeder arrived and still my cardinals will not use this feeder the perch is too shallow and slippery for my cardinals , gross beaks, blue jays. I am disappointed as this feeder is right out my kitchen window and the traffic to this feeder is not even half as much as we had before. I will be searching for another feeder to bring my favorite birds around again. Feeder is built fine and sturdy but, not a good design for larger birds.

Quality build, easy to fill and clean, so well designed
Yes ! Love, love this. Very sturdy construction. Great hanger included. No sharp edges. Looks like there is a poly coat on the surface which makes it a nice slick surface that's easy to hose clean. Super easy to fill with the hinged side of the roof. Have not had a problem with the seed getting wet in the bin. The side cages for the cakes are easy to pop on and fill easily. It even has confounded the squirrels --I hate to see them starve so they can get some seed out of the openings, but it's much harder and they move on. The birds love it. Have Kaytee fruit and nut blend in it now.
